Gibson, who was once a member of a rap group called Triple Impact, released his self-titled debut music album, which went platinum, in 1998; his second album, 2000 Watts, shares the name of the organization he founded to help inner city children. Gibson was given the role originally intended for the late 2Pac Shakur in the 2001 film Baby Boy; the movie was a critical success and performed fairly at the box office. Gibson subsequently appeared in the 2003 box office success 2 Fast 2 Furious (opposite Paul Walker, with whom he formed a close friendship during filming), as well as Flight of the Phoenix (2004), Four Brothers (2005) and Annapolis (2006), co-starring James Franco. Gibson was picked as one of People Magazine’s Sexiest Men of the Year in 2000.
Gibson has also established himself as a successful screenwriter, selling the pitches D.A. Verdict to MGM and Extortion to Universal Studios. In 2006, Gibson sold his first original spec script, To Each His Own, to Screen Gems. He is to star in and produce all of the films. Gibson has also created HQ Pictures, a television and film production company. He has hired Mike Le as VP of development & production to oversee and develop projects under the company’s banner.
Gibson prefers his music career to acting, but will focus on both areas. His third album is called Alter Ego, and featured both R&B and hip hop songs. He used an alias, “Black Ty”, for the rap tracks. Tyrese had a role in the Transformers movie, released July of 2007; the film’s director, Michael Bay, had Gibson in mind for the role before he was cast, and thus Gibson did not have to audition for the part.
Tyrese's fourth and latest album Open Invitation was released on November 1, 2011 in the US. It was preceeded by the single "Stay" which peaked on U.S. Billboard R&B/Hip-Hop Songs at number 11. The second single "Too Easy" features Ludacris and was released soon after.

The lyrics of Tyrese's song Make Up Your Mind explores a relationship that is at the brink of failing due to the lack of commitment by one party. The song opens up with a prayer-like phrase asking God to bless the day the singer found their love interest. They express their confusion about why their partner does not believe in them despite their efforts. The singer feels as if their partner is not on the same page and unable to commit to the relationship fully. They are pained by the fact that their partner tells them they have changed but continues to exhibit the same traits. The singer recognizes the games played, and they feel that it's time to move on. In the chorus, Tyrese urges his partner to make up their mind and commit to the relationship wholly.
Tyrese's song Make Up Your Mind portrays the consequences of lack of commitment in a relationship. The singer also acknowledges the games played in relationships, showcasing how manipulation can affect a relationship.
